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Broad-Bordered White Underwing | Collalba Afgana |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(artrópodos) | Chordata (cordados) |
| Class | Insecta (insecto) | Aves (Birds)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Passeriformes (paseriformes) |
| Family | Noctuidae | Muscicapidae |
| Genus | Anarta | Oenanthe |
| Species | Anarta melanopa | Oenanthe chrysopygia |
Evolutionary Relationship
Broad-Bordered White Underwing and Collalba Afgana share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
